As nouns, marriage is a hypernym of bigamy; that is, marriage is a word with a broader meaning than bigamy:
  • bigamy: the state of having two spouses at the same time
  • marriage: the state of being a married couple voluntarily joined for life (or until divorce)
Other hypernyms of bigamy include matrimony, spousal relationship, union, wedlock.
